THE OPPORTUNITY

We are seeking safety and quality- conscious Electrical Site Supervisor to join the team. This is a Monday-Friday role working in Tumut.

Based at the foothills of the Snowy Mountains, PHE’s Tumut operations undertakes small and large scale project work within the iconic Snowy Mountains Hydro Electric Scheme. The role involves the supervision of industrial electrical and instrumentation installations at various power station and infrastructure sites throughout the ‘Snowy’ and broader region on rosters that balance regular overtime and time at home.

In this role, you will:

  • Lead a team to deliver safe, productive and quality electrical and instrumentation installations in industrial settings.
  •  Report project status, including forecast outcomes with relation to time, cost, scope and quality when required.
  • Maintain records of work-in-progress and communications in line with the project management methodology.
  •  Participate in and inform project planning and auditing activities.
  • Oversee PHE apprentices and ensure they are consistently learning and improving their standard of work.

ABOUT YOU

To be successful you will have the following skills and experience: 

  • Experienced leading a team made up of leading hands, electricians, other trades, apprentices and non-trades people on industrial sites.
  • Must be able to lead a team that maintains an excellent attitude to safety through leading by example.
  • The ability to lead a highly productive team to meet project and company objectives.
  • Possess a high level of written and verbal communication skills and the ability to maintain long-term client relationships.
  • Enjoy problem-solving.
  • Familiar with Microsoft Office 365 applications including Teams and Excel.
  • Quality Management experience.
  • Budget management experience.
  • Flexible and open to working away from home, as required by the company.

The successful candidate will have:

  • Trade Certification / AQF Cert Level 3 Electro Tech
  • NSW Electrical Licence
  • High risk work licence with WP Class
  • Working at Heights certificate within the past 2 years
  • LVR/CPR certificate within the past 12 months
  • White Construction Card
  • C Class Drivers Licence
  • Hold or be able to obtain a National Police Clearance

ABOUT PHE GROUP and PHE POWER & INFRASTRUCTURE

PHE Group is an electrical and instrumentation contractor with five specialist divisions and more than 50 years’ experience. From design and installation to commissioning, shutdowns and logistics, we deliver projects that last.

With branches and projects across Australia’s key mining regions, we’re trusted to deliver where it matters most.

Through PHE Power & Infrastructure, our people deliver electrical, instrumentation and automation services that keep essential infrastructure running – across energy, water and industrial sectors. From integrating renewables to executing large-scale upgrades and strengthening critical power resilience, we work closely with clients to keep complex programs moving. At every stage of their career, our people are supported to learn, grow and succeed, while gaining exposure to the projects shaping Australia’s future.

As part of PHE Group, our reputation is reinforced by  recent recognition at both State and National levels. At the 2025 NECA SA/NT Excellence Awards, we secured honours across the Industrial Large ($2M–$20M) and Industrial X-Large ($20M+) categories for BHP’s Carrapateena Hydrofloat and Underground Crusher 2.0 projects respectively. We also received the Perpetual Award – the judges’ highest accolade, reserved for the project they consider the standout submission across all categories – recognising excellence in safety, quality, innovation and culture. 

This success was followed by national recognition at the 2025 NECA National Excellence Awards, where PHE Group received the Industrial X-Large Project ($20M+) award for the Carrapateena Underground Crusher 2.0 project, and a Certificate of Commendation – Industrial Large ($2M–$20M) for the Carrapateena Hydrofloat project.
